If upon a canvass of the votes cast at the election, it appears that the votes cast for creation of the proposed county are 50 percent or less, of the total number of votes cast within each and every affected county, or 50 percent or less of the total number of votes cast within the proposed county, the board of supervisors of the principal county shall, by resolution, declare creation of the proposed county defeated and no further proceedings for creation of a county with substantially the same territory as the proposed county shall be initiated for a period of one year after the date of the election, except as otherwise provided in Section 23330.5.
